Motorola PEBL U6 Review - MobileBurn
MobileBurn reviews the Motorola PEBL U6, and finds that while it might not have a lot of high-end features, it's an affordable phone with a unique design and available in lots of colors that will likely appeal to a lot of users. About the phone's camera: "The PEBL U6's camera supports only VGA (640x480) resolution, but manages to take reasonable photos none the less. Images are for the most part properly exposed, and the automatic white balance system does a very good job of keeping the colors accurate - better than even the available manual settings in many situations. The UI on the camera is not as advanced as you will see on the newer motorola designs, in that the d-pad can only be used for adjusting exposure and digital zoom, but it works well enough."
